Planting Calendar for Lisianthus

Frost tolerance for lisianthus: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ost.

Lisianthus require warm weather which means that it is necessary to wait until it warms up after all chance of fr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ant lisianthus in Massena is May. However, you really should wait until June if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ant lisianthus and expect a good harvest is probably August.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your lisianthus may not have a chance to grow to maturity. If you are starting your lisianthus indoors then you might be able to get away with starting them a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

On average all chance of frost has passed is on May 15 in Massena. In the coldest months of winter you should expect an average low temperature of -25°F.

Since the USDA zone info for Massena is just an average the actual date of last frost is different every year. Half of the time in Massena it frosts late in the year after May 15 so always be ready to protect your lisianthus in the event of one of those late frosts.

USDA Zone Info for Massena

Here is the info for USDA Zone 4b.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)May 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)September 15
Lowest Expected Low-25°F
Highest Expected Low-20°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is -25°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near -20°F.
